Chapter 830 The Will Passed Down Through Generations
This occurred two weeks before Roger met Whitebeard.
The name of Gol D. Roger, the Pirate King, spread throughout the seas, and the news bird carried the news of the Pirate King's birth to all corners of the world.
The entire Grand Line was in an uproar; an unprecedented event shook the world.
The Navy launched an unusually large-scale operation, and even the pirates of the Grand Line took action, targeting Roger.
"Roger, that man, he got everything!"
"Wealth, fame, power—he left everything he had on the final island!"
"Kill Roger, and the One Piece he left behind will be ours!"
"Speaking of which... why is Gol D. Roger's treasure called ONE PIECE?"
"Who knows? The important thing is Roger's treasure!"
"Go find Roger! He has all sorts of treasures!"
Whether it's the navy, pirates, or any other force, everyone is stirred up by this man's deeds.
And at this time.
On a certain ocean in the New World, the pirate ship Oro Jackson is sailing through the waves.
"Well then, I have my announcement to make."
Roger looked at his companions, with whom he had sailed for many years.
"The Roger Pirates are hereby disbanded!"
After saying this, they held one last lavish party on the ship.
Amidst the clinking of glasses, the sounds of singing and laughter mingling with the roar of the waves, the great voyage around the world was about to come to an end.
"Laugh Tale, we've arrived too early."
Who will find the vast, interconnected treasure trove, ONE PIECE?
“Of course it will be my son!” Roger suddenly interjected.
"Where did you get a son from?" Riley asked, embarrassed.
"Just go have one, then..." Roger laughed nonchalantly.
Becoming a pirate and embarking on an adventure in the Grand Line means leaving home and peaceful days behind.
Many of them have been away from their hometowns and families for many years, and many are still unmarried, including Roger, who is now 52 years old.
"Seriously... I plan to go see Whitebeard one last time."
At this point, Roger suddenly paused:
"As for the other guy who likes to disappear and can disappear for many years, it's probably too late to see him again."
As the banquet drew to a close, the pirate ship arrived at an island.
The ship's doctor, Crocus, prepared Roger's luggage: it mainly contained a large amount of medicine, which would prolong Roger's life even after he left.
last of the last.
Roger and Rayleigh walked aside and gave Rayleigh, who had been the first to board the ship, their final words.
“Rayleigh, as you know, we’re too early.”
"So... after I leave, you should all just wait quietly."
"Perhaps one day in the future, someone we are waiting for, who has not yet been born, will surpass us and do things that we cannot do."
"In that new era, the Roger Pirates may one day reunite."
Rayleigh covered his face with his hand, seemingly wanting to say something but stopping himself.
Roger noticed his wavering, but said nothing, only chuckled softly.
He slung his bag over his shoulder and casually placed the straw hat on Shanks, who was already in tears.
"Shanks, men don't need tears when they part."
"I'm entrusting this straw hat to you for safekeeping."
He seemed to have thought of something, a smile playing on his lips, and he chuckled softly:
"And I will not die."
Leaving those words behind, he walked slowly off the boat alone, gradually disappearing into the distance.
Everyone on the ship was in tears.
Only Rayleigh turned his back at that moment, not looking at Roger's departing figure.

half a month later.
Under the trees where cherry blossoms flutter.
Roger and Whitebeard sat on the ground, each with a bottle of liquor beside them.
"Are you saying you're going to die, Roger?"
"Yes, I don't have much time left."
"By the way... do you know what the people from the World Government have been calling me lately?"
Roger smiled slightly:
"Goldo Roger".
"What? That's your real name?"
"No!" Roger laughed, slapping the ground as he said seriously.
"My name is Gol D. Roger!"
"Indeed." The white-bearded man poured himself another bowl of wine.
"On the high seas, you might occasionally encounter someone whose name contains the letter 'D'."
"Just like Rocks D. Giebeck back then... Speaking of which, I also have a Teach on my ship."
"Teach...you mean that brat who can't sleep?"
Roger smiled, then suddenly remembered something, took off his captain's hat, and placed it on the ground.
"Whitebeard, do me a favor."
"I've been waiting for someone to come along, but I've run out of time to wait."
"If you ever meet someone on the high seas who deserves this hat, please give it to him on my behalf."
Roger said seriously.
Whitebeard silently glanced at the captain's hat on the ground a few times.
"This hat, doesn't it look like it belonged to Rocks?"
“Not bad,” Roger said in a low voice.
"Although I received Rocks' hat, I never intended to inherit his will."
"That guy Rocks probably had the same idea as me, which is why he handed the hat to me before he died."
"The will of Lox?"
The white-bearded man lowered his eyelids and gently raised the captain's hat.
"I really wish I could live a few more decades to witness the future, but it's too late," Roger laughed loudly.
"Will someone appear in the future to inherit this hat?"
"Will that person in the future be a sea tyrant like him? Or will he be a divine enemy who dares to challenge the Celestial Dragons?"
At this point, Roger burst into a mischievous laugh:
"If you think your son who doesn't like to sleep deserves this hat, I have no objection to giving it to him."
“Teach? He doesn’t seem like that kind of ambitious guy.”
Whitebeard shook his head.
Speaking of hats, he was reminded of someone else.
"Speaking of which, wasn't this hat originally placed on Rocks by King Siegfried himself back on Scarborough Island?"
"really."
Roger nodded, his cheerful smile momentarily froze:
"That guy disappears for years at a time, I guess I'll never see him again..."
.......
At the end of Roger's pirate career.
Pirate King Gol D. Roger and his strongest rival, Whitebeard Edward Newgate, drink and chat under a cherry blossom tree.
Finally, he put down the captain's hat and left.
